Uninstall Application on Windows 11

There are different ways to uninstall an app, and I will show you three ways that you can use to remove an app that you no longer need. You can pick whichever method you find easiest.

Uninstall Application on Windows 11 Start Menu

Step-1: Click on the Windows icon on the taskbar. Then click on the All apps option in the top right corner.

Step-2: When the app list opens, right-click on the app and select Uninstall.

Step-3: If the app you select is a Microsoft store app, you will get a dialogue box asking you for confirmation. Click Uninstall.

If the app you select is not a Microsoft Store app, you will be directed to the Control Panel. If you are directed to the Control Panel, move to the next steps; otherwise, move on to the following method.

Step-4: When the Control Panel opens, select the app and select the Uninstall option.

Step-5: You will be asked, do you want to allow this app to make changes to your device? Click Yes.

Settings

You can also uninstall from the Settings app:

  1.  Open Settings using the shortcut keys Win + I. You can also open it by clicking on the Windows icon on the taskbar and selecting the Settings cog.
    Open Settings
  2.  Select Apps from the left pane.
    Settings App
  3.  Select Apps & Features from the right pane.

  4.  Next to the app that you wish to uninstall, click on the three vertical dots. Select Uninstall.

  5.  Click Uninstall again.

  6.  This step would apply to you if you chose a non-Microsoft app to uninstall. After you clicked uninstall a second time, you will be asked, do you want to allow this app to make changes to your device? Click Yes.

Control Panel

In Windows 11, the Control Panel isn’t completely separate from the Settings app. You can uninstall in Control Panel, too, without accessing the Settings app.

Step-1: Click on the search icon on the taskbar and type Control Panel. Click Open.

Step-2: Select Uninstall a program option.

Step-3: Click on the app you wish to uninstall and click on the uninstall option at the top of the window.

Step-4: You will be asked, do you want to allow this app to make changes to your device? Click Yes.
